Popular Nollywood actress, Funke Akindele has revealed that her first marriage ended because she rushed into it due to societal pressures.
She made this revelation in an old interview with media personality, Chude Jidenowo which has recently resurfaced online.
According to her, she just wanted to settle down and have children because she was under pressure, but sadly the marriage ended after a year.
She narrated how she was able to overcome this terrible period in her life by focusing solely on her work as a distraction and advised single ladies to avoid rushing into marriage because if they do, they will rush out of the marriage like she did.
She said;
“I have never addressed this issue but I will do now to encourage ladies that are pressured to get married. Please calm down and take your time because if you rush in, you rush out…that is the lesson learnt….I just wanted to get married then, have children because I was being pressurized by society, here and there….and then it didn’t work out and ended in a bad way….I was filming when the news broke on social media, I wanted to die, i lost some good deals and all but i didn’t let it break me….”
She added, “I channeled my energy into work, made money and i saved a lot, i will wake up early to work….there will always be bad times but you will survive, don’t let it weigh you down because it will pass and because you serve a living God…there are times anger and jealousy will come, but don’t let it eat you up, as a young lady don’t be pressured into marriage, marry cos you love him and want to be with him not cos the society and everyone is pressuring you to, ignore the naysayers…..do what makes you happy…”

A Nigerian man, identified as Shamseddin Giwa, has recounted how he and his wife were forced to return to their home country after relocating abroad in search of greener pastures.
In a candid social media post he titled “The Relocation Story You Don’t Get Told,” Giwa revealed that he and his wife had moved abroad years ago with high hopes of a brighter future.
However, their expectations were shattered as they encountered unforeseen challenges.
“This was us several years back as a young couple looking for better life abroad. The dream was good, the intentions were good and we had enough to start.
“We just didn’t have enough information of how challenging it would get. We started life in a single room within a shared flat where we even got told when we could use the washing machine or turn on the heater (even in winter).” He shared.
Speaking further, he noted that when things didn’t seem to get better, and it became difficult to live averagely they made the hard decision to return to Nigeria and start over.
“The jobs were demeaning and always tiring but the poor exchange rate of my home currency gave a false sense of deception that one was earning good but the reality was different. Even with both our incomes, it was difficult to live averagely. Note: we were way better than others here!
At least we were together but extreme work rota meant we barely got to spend time together, marriage strained. Now imagine many had their spouses back home and their marriages went through worse.
Always at the mercy of the home office that was always changing immigration policies, one never truly felt settled. In the end, we returned back home and quietly started over, together.” He added.
Reflecting on their experience years later, Giwa expressed gratitude for their decision to come back to Nigeria, as they have achieved everything they once sought abroad.
Advising those considering relocating abroad, Giwa stressed the importance of thorough research and having a solid exit plan in case things don’t go as planned.
“Now imagine many still stuck, illegally living, unable to work for standard rates, unable to even rent a place in their name, unable to open an account, unable to have peace of mind and always apprehensive of law enforcement, unable to grow yet unable to return home!
What’s the point? Relocating will test you and your marriage in different ways. Please be sure before you copy anyone and sell all you have to move. However, if you find yourself stuck, have a good exit plan even if it means coming back home to start over.
Many people and marriages are breaking due to the pressure unplanned. Don’t go this route, do your findings well, your home depends on it.” He wrote.
